Description
This Mediterranean winter active grass has the ability to grow more winter feed and is later maturing than traditional fescues. This drought-tolerant species grows vigorously from Autumn to Spring whilst becoming dormant in Summer. Charlem is a deep-rooted, perennial grass that grows in tussocks, being an ideal Lucerne companion plant. This variety’s ability to produce very high dry matter levels and its palatability make it a great nutritious feed option throughout Winter and into early Spring.
Agronomic Information:
- Sowing Rates 10-20kg/ha as a standalone crop or 4-10kg/ha as part of a mix
- Rainfall 450mm+
- Fescue is commonly sown with Phalaris or cocksfoot. Avoid sowing with ryegrass as it will crowd out fescue seedlings
- Will cope in poorly drained soils and occasional waterlogging.
